'water system' I assume you mean the engine cooling system. It is straight forward but there are several steps and things to consider/be prepared for......
Get the Haynes manual for Citroen Saxo. Read the section for changing the engine coolant thoroughly so you know about all the steps before you start. Assemble the consumables you will need, remember that engine coolant can damage paint, and make up a temporary coolant reservoir out of an old plastic bottle.... A container to catch the old coolant is useful, a hose pipe/water for flushing system is useful, decent coolant is useful (you get what you pay for), plenty of time is useful (some of the pipes you have to disconnect may take some shifting), and finally with all due respect, some DIY skills/aptitude are essential for the fiddly bits. Otherwise you will end up with air locks and overheating of the engine and require an extensive paint touch up
